Abstract
The biological activities of the calix[n]arenes have been extensively reported on, with regard to various forms of life ranging from self-replicating systems, such as, viruses, through bacteria, fungi and mammalian cells to human beings. This article reviews more than one hundred different calix[n]arenes classified according to their biological effects directly observed on living species. These macrocyclic molecules have been reported as detoxifying agents, as having antibacterial, antiviral, anticoagulant, anticancer, antifungal activities, as membrane protein modulators / extracters, drug transporters and fluorescent probes. Special in vivo sections, have been inserted when possible for each biological effect showing the impact of the calix[n]arenes on whole living system such as animals or humans.
